Compare Laguna Beach to Santa Barbara

This post compares Laguna Beach, California to Santa Barbara,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Laguna Beach (city) Santa Barbara (city)
Population 23,224 91,443
Income (median) $100,466 $49,574
Home Value (median) $1,570,700 $934,500
White 88% 77%
Black 0% 1%
Asian 4% 3%
With Kids 21% 23%
Age (median) 50 37
Rentals 37% 59%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Laguna Beach or Santa Barbara?
A: Laguna Beach has a much smaller population count than Santa Barbara: 23224 compared with 91443 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Laguna Beach or in Santa Barbara?
A: Incomes are on average much higher in Laguna Beach.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Laguna Beach or Santa Barbara?
A: Homes tend to be more expensive in Laguna Beach.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Santa Barbara does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 37% for Laguna Beach versus 59% for Santa Barbara.
